+include "../lib/display.h"
+include "../lib/center.h"
+include "../lib/fitsky.h"
+include "../lib/phot.h"
+include "../lib/polyphot.h"
+
+# AP_GCEPARS -- Read in the centering algorithm parameters from the
+# centerpars parameter file.
+
+procedure ap_gcepars (ap)
+
+pointer ap # pointer to the apphot structure
+
+int function
+pointer sp, str, pp
+bool clgpsetb()
+int strdic(), btoi(), clgpseti()
+pointer clopset()
+real clgpsetr()
+
+begin
+ call smark (sp)
+ call salloc (str, SZ_LINE, TY_CHAR)
+
+ # Open the pset parameter file.
+ pp = clopset ("centerpars")
+
+ # Get the centering parameters.
+ call clgpset (pp, "calgorithm", Memc[str], SZ_LINE)
+ function = strdic (Memc[str], Memc[str], SZ_LINE, CFUNCS)
+ call apsets (ap, CSTRING, Memc[str])
+ call apseti (ap, CENTERFUNCTION, function)
+ call apsetr (ap, CAPERT, clgpsetr (pp, "cbox") / 2.0)
+ call apsetr (ap, CTHRESHOLD, clgpsetr (pp, "cthreshold"))
+ call apsetr (ap, MINSNRATIO, clgpsetr (pp, "minsnratio"))
+ call apseti (ap, CMAXITER, clgpseti (pp, "cmaxiter"))
+ call apsetr (ap, MAXSHIFT, clgpsetr (pp, "maxshift"))
+ call apseti (ap, CLEAN, btoi (clgpsetb (pp, "clean")))
+ call apsetr (ap, RCLEAN, clgpsetr (pp, "rclean"))
+ call apsetr (ap, RCLIP, clgpsetr (pp, "rclip"))
+ call apsetr (ap, SIGMACLEAN, clgpsetr (pp, "kclean"))
+
+ call apseti (ap, MKCENTER, btoi (clgpsetb (pp, "mkcenter")))
+
+
+ # Close the parameter set file.
+ call clcpset (pp)
+
+ call sfree (sp)
+end
+
+
+# AP_GSAPARS -- Read in the sky fitting parameters from the fitskypars
+# parameter file.
+
+procedure ap_gsapars (ap)
+
+pointer ap # pointer to the apphot strucuture
+
+int function
+pointer sp, str, pp
+bool clgpsetb()
+int strdic(), clgpseti(), btoi()
+pointer clopset()
+real clgpsetr()
+
+begin
+ call smark (sp)
+ call salloc (str, SZ_LINE, TY_CHAR)
+
+ # Open the pset parameter file.
+ pp = clopset ("fitskypars")
+
+ # Get the sky fitting algorithm parameters.
+ call clgpset (pp, "salgorithm", Memc[str], SZ_LINE)
+ function = strdic (Memc[str], Memc[str], SZ_LINE, SFUNCS)
+ call apsets (ap, SSTRING, Memc[str])
+ call apseti (ap, SKYFUNCTION, function)
+ call apsetr (ap, SKY_BACKGROUND, clgpsetr (pp, "skyvalue"))
+ call apsetr (ap, ANNULUS, clgpsetr (pp, "annulus"))
+ call apsetr (ap, DANNULUS, clgpsetr (pp, "dannulus"))
+ call apsetr (ap, K1, clgpsetr (pp, "khist"))
+ call apsetr (ap, BINSIZE, clgpsetr (pp, "binsize"))
+ call apseti (ap, SMOOTH, btoi (clgpsetb (pp, "smooth")))
+ call apseti (ap, SMAXITER, clgpseti (pp, "smaxiter"))
+ call apsetr (ap, SLOCLIP, clgpsetr (pp, "sloclip"))
+ call apsetr (ap, SHICLIP, clgpsetr (pp, "shiclip"))
+ call apseti (ap, SNREJECT, clgpseti (pp, "snreject"))
+ call apsetr (ap, SLOREJECT, clgpsetr (pp, "sloreject"))
+ call apsetr (ap, SHIREJECT, clgpsetr (pp, "shireject"))
+ call apsetr (ap, RGROW, clgpsetr (pp, "rgrow"))
+
+ # Get the marking parameter.
+ call apseti (ap, MKSKY, btoi (clgpsetb (pp, "mksky")))
+
+ # Close the parameter set file.
+ call clcpset (pp)
+
+ call sfree (sp)
+end
